Geotechnical website investigation is a crucial action in the preparation and implementation of any kind of construction job. It entails the collection and analysis of data connected to the physical properties of soil and rock underneath a proposed building and construction site. This info is important for the layout and building of safe, stable, and sustainable frameworks.

, also understood as subsurface exploration, entails a collection of activities aimed at establishing the dirt, rock, and groundwater problems at a building site. The main purposes are to identify prospective geotechnical dangers, assess the design buildings of subsurface products, and offer recommendations for the layout and building and construction of structures, keeping wall surfaces, and other structures.


The workdesk study assists in recognizing possible geotechnical concerns and planning the subsequent fieldwork. This involves observing the topography, drain patterns, existing structures, plants, and any signs of instability or disintegration.

Superficial test pits are excavated to straight observe and example the soil and rock. This approach is useful for researching the top layers of the subsurface and determining near-surface risks. Non-invasive geophysical methods, such as seismic refraction, ground-penetrating radar (GPR), and electrical resistivity tomography (ERT), are used to map subsurface conditions and find anomalies.


Soil and rock examples collected throughout the area examination are subjected to research laboratory screening to establish their physical and mechanical buildings. These examinations supply necessary data for geotechnical analysis and layout.


The main benefit of geotechnical site examination is ensuring the safety and security and security of structures. By understanding the subsurface conditions, engineers can make structures and other structural components that can hold up against the loads and environmental forces they will certainly go through. This lessens the threat of negotiation, subsidence, and structural failing.

The Leaning Tower of Pisa (Italy), a famous building marvel, is infamous for its unintended tilt from significant geotechnical concerns. The tower's structure was sites inadequately created to manage the soft, unsteady soil beneath it, causing unequal settlement and its distinct lean. Geotechnical design is a customized field within civil engineering that focuses on researching the behavior of planet materials. This branch dives deep right into the groundinvestigating how the soil, rock, and groundwater at a construction site can influenceand be influenced bythe infrastructure that we erect on and into them. Prior to a single brick is laid or a concrete foundation poured, geotechnical designers probe into the earthgathering essential data about the more info here site's soil structure, rock framework, and groundwater levels.
